The Missouri Board of Pharmacy will be allowed to test drugs in pharmacy inventories under a new law just signed by Missouri Governor Jay Nixon. Under the new law, the Board will have the authority to establish a program for testing drugs, including compounded drugs, held by licensees. Board personnel currently may enter and inspect premises that sell drugs or chemicals. The full text of the bill is available on the Web site of the Missouri Senate.
